- 1、本文档共5页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
004 朱冰 港口工程压电缆电缆选型的自动化尝试 删减版004 朱冰 港口工程低压电缆电缆选型的自动化尝试 删减版
港口工程低压电缆电缆选型的自动化尝试
摘要:在港口电力系统中,用电设备的种类与数量在增多、设备容量在也在不断增大、各种设备之间的互相影响也在加强,因而人们也更加关注电力系统运行的可靠性与安全性。本文主要针对港口工程低压电缆选型自动化进行了研究,部分实现了电缆电缆选型的自动化。
关键词:港口工程;低压电缆;电缆选型;自动化选型;Excel;VBA
由于港口工程的特殊性,电力输送主要采用放射式电力电缆线路,一个港口工程会涉及大量的低压电缆线路。
低压电缆选型的繁复过程主要集中在过负载保护及电压降的校验这两部分。本文将集中讨论配电线路根据负荷特性、线路长度及电压降要求进行电缆选型的自动计算方法。可以为配电线路的完整保护提供初步依据。加快设计速度、提高设计精度。
本文使用软件为Excel及其附带的VBA系统。文中将根据设计思路分部阐述设计方??,并附带相关代码。
限于篇幅,各参数的意义及功能实现我将在功能与代码解析中一并说明,一些代码在不影响功能说明的情况下省略部分内容。
1.港口低压电缆选型计算分析基本参数
上图将每个设备的供电回路参数一一列出。分为输入参数、参考参数(根据输入参数,通过计算或查找得到的间接参数)和输出参数三类。
其中输入参数包括:负荷名称、回路编号、Pc(计算容量)、回路长度、cosφ(设备功率因数)、Un(电压等级)、设定电压降、载流量矫正系数、TN-S/TN-C(系统形式)、开关降容系数。
参考参数:Ic(计算电流)、电缆型号(在同一回路的计算过程中,电缆型号会进行若干次试错、更新。所以将其也归入参考参数。)、额定载流量、开关整定值、Re、Xe、sinφ、Voltage drop (电压降)。
输出参数:电缆型号。
2. 港口低电压电缆选型功能与代码解析
在工程中,通常是按照载流量来选择电缆的,之后在对电压降进行校验,并使之达到设计的要求。本文探讨用Excel及vba编程的方法来实现上述机械的电缆选型。Excel主视图如下:
本表是某港口工程,低压电缆选型的一部分内容。只需要输入计算负荷就能够根据设定好的载流量折算系数、电降压要求、回路长度以及从电缆参数表内自动取得的参数,来选择出合适的电缆型号。
电缆参数表部分内容如下:
2.1 vlookup函数的使用
电缆参数表作为一个可以根据实际情况更改和删减的数据库,将其做成表的形式直观的表现在Excel中是合适的。而利用vloolup函数就可以将其中的参数根据电缆型号的变化自动输入到主视图内。本文主视图的额定载流量对应列的vlookup的用法为“=VLOOKUP(G18,电缆参数表!$B:$AA,2,FALSE)”,Re、Xe对应列用法类似。
2.2 电缆选型的VBA代码
2.2.1 数组及其定义
Dim breaker(30) As Integer
breaker(0) = 16
breaker(1) = 16
…
breaker(8) = 63
…
Dim breaker(30)定义了30个整数数据,表示断路器整定值。
Dim cable(30) As String 定义cable数组元素,一一对应breaker数组元素
cable(0) = 4x10
…
cable(4) = 4x10
…
cable(23) = 4(3x185+1x95)
…
Dim cable(30)定义了30个字符串数据,表示电缆型号。一一对应breaker数组元素。
Dim cable5(30) As String 定义cable5数组元素,一一对应breaker和cable数组元素。cable5表示5芯电缆,用于TN-S系统。
cable5(0) = 5x10
…
cable5(5) = 5x10
…
cable5(15) = 3x150+2x70
Dim cable5(30)定义了30个字符串数据,表示5芯电缆,用于TN-S系统。一一对应breaker数组元素。
2.2.2 初始化电缆型号
在程序中VBA代码会调用主视图中的输入参数和参考参数。而部分参考参数取决于电缆型号。所以在程序一开始先对电缆型号列进行初始化赋值。
初始化赋值代码如下:
For line_countrage_part1 = 4 To 200 初始化电缆型号
Cells(line_countrage_part1, cable_clone) = cable(0)
Next line_countrage_part1
其中line_countrage_part1参数作为行计数,cable_clone为电缆型号所在的列,cable(0)为4x10。
这段程序执行完毕则4~200行的电缆型
您可能关注的文档
- 高压变电站电磁辐射的测量和分析高压变电站电磁辐射的测量和分析.doc
- 高压开关制造行业现状及市场未来发展前景分析高压开关制造行业现状及市场未来发展前景分析.doc
- 2015年浙江省高校招职业技能考试大纲-计算机类2015年浙江省高校招生职业技能考试大纲-计算机类.doc
- 2015年深圳学文教育训项目招生简介2015年深圳学文教育培训项目招生简介.doc
- 高处坠落事故的对策及措施高处坠落事故的对策及措施.doc
- 2015年深圳市市属事单位考试大纲2015年深圳市市属事业单位考试大纲.doc
- 高处防坠落专项方案高处防坠落专项方案.doc
- 高处施工预防坠落监理实施细则AXZ04高处施工预防坠落监理实施细则AXZ04.doc
- 高大墩身施工安全防护专项方案高大墩身施工安全防护专项方案.doc
- 2015年湖北高考英语导:阅读理解推理判断题解题技巧2015年湖北高考英语辅导:阅读理解推理判断题解题技巧.doc
文档评论(0)